Murata components help increase the comfort and convenience of these products. Smartphones contain general-purpose products from Murata, such as monolithic ceramic capacitors and microwave products, while Murata ultra-small modules are employed for wireless LAN functions, a must in these intelligent products. Murata products used in hybrid vehicles include highly reliable monolithic ceramic capacitors, noise suppression products, and sensors.
